Equivalent
1. MAX485 by Maxim Integrated
2. SN75176B by Texas Instruments
3. ADM485 by Analog Devices
4. SP485 by MaxLinear
5. ISL83485 by Renesas
These alternatives offer similar functionalities and specifications, such as low power consumption, differential signaling, and compatibility with RS-485/RS-422 communication standards.
Features
1. Data Rate: Supports data transmission speeds up to 5 Mbps.
2. Supply Voltage: Operates from a supply voltage range of 4.75V to 5.25V.
3. Low Power Consumption: Offers low power operation with a supply current of typically 300 µA.
4. Wide Common Mode Range: Allows for differential signals over a wide range, enhancing noise immunity.
5. Short-Circuit Protection: Provides protection against short circuits on the bus lines.
6. Thermal Shutdown: Includes thermal shutdown protection to prevent damage from overheating.
7. ESD Protection: Features Electrostatic Discharge (ESD) protection for enhanced reliability.
8. Fail-Safe Receiver: Ensures a known output state when the bus is idle, open, or shorted.
9. Package: Available in SO-8 package, suitable for space-constrained applications.
These features make the ST485ABDR a robust solution for reliable data communication in electrically noisy environments.
Pinout
1. RO (Receive Output): Outputs the received data from the bus.
2. RE̅ (Receive Enable): Active-low input; enables the receiver output when low.
3. DE (Driver Enable): Controls the driver; when high, the driver is enabled.
4. DI (Driver Input): Data input for the driver.
5. GND: Ground reference for the device.
6. A (Non-inverting Driver Output / Receiver Input): One of the differential bus lines.
7. B (Inverting Driver Output / Receiver Input): The other differential bus line.
8. VCC: Supply voltage for the device.
